In a society of conscious machines tasked with spreading the human race to new planets, a philosophical robot is sent to investigate the ghost-ship remnant of a previous (non-conscious) mission, but soon finds themselves facing a growing zombie-robot army that threatens both society and mission.

      When an android sent to investigate the disappearance of a colonisation space ship discovers an armada of self replicating robots, he must stop the invasion before they reach earth.

      I changed the zombie robot to self replicating robot, but body snatcher could also do the trick.
      Also I made your protagonist an android as it sound better than philosophical robot or synthetic or AI.

      I have fewer problems with the zombie aspect being overdone as I am confused as to what is a zombie robot.

      Also, what do you mean by a non-conscious mission, are the passengers in cryogenic sleep? (In which you should just say that) or are the passenger’s non-sentient robots? (In which you should just say that)

      I guess my issue is, why would conscious machines do our bidding at all? As above, Zombie anything is a killer for my interest at the moment.

      A conscious robot sent to Earth to use the planet as a resource, but doing so well end humanity not doing so ends the life of his race would be more interesting albeit similar to The Day The Earth Stood Still.

      Maybe he stumbles upon the planet before we existed and most choose between the hours people at the end of their life of an untested people just at the beginning of theirs.

      Having a robot protagonist is fine, even the idea of looking for a new home is good, but after that I feel it needs work.

      IMHO. zombie anything has been so overdone it’s become a cliche.? What studios are looking for is a fresh new foe — not a knock off of an existing one.

      Also,? the logline casts no human characters.? The protagonist is a robot. (Did the AI machines make up the mission of infecting other planets with homo sapiens on their own?)?
